1. Niagara Falls Wonder Pass, from $21.94

Travel to Niagara Falls in the summer and take advantage of the Niagara Falls Wonder Pass, which offers passes to 3 magical Niagara Falls Experiences: Journey Behind the Falls, Butterfly Conservatory and Niagara Fury.

2. Victoria Whale Watch Tour, from $103.53

Embark on an enchanting journey to Victoria onboard a comfortable boat and see orcas, humpback whales, gray whales, and minke whales with the help of an expert naturalist guide. Be on the lookout for other marine life as well, like sea lions, elephant seals, harbour seals, and sea birds!

3. Vancouver City Sightseeing Tour, from $75

Take a fast course on Vancouver. This 4-hour sightseeing tour will take you through notable spots like Stanley Park, Chinatown, Gastown, and Granville Park. It’s a wonderful opportunity to learn about Vancouver’s history and get soaked up in its lively cultural atmosphere.

4. Discover Grizzly Bears from Banff, from $179.06

Come face to face with the grizzly bears in their natural habitat! You will take a gondola ride for a great view of the grizzly country and visit the refuge, where the orphaned sloth of bears romp and play around. You will also enjoy stops at Lake Louise, Takkakaw Falls and Kicking Horse Canyon. Everything about this trip promises to be wild.

5. Glacier Skywalk Admission, from $24.95

Want to get your heart racing? Experience a rush high above the 1,312-foot-long walkway in Jasper, known as the Glacier Skywalk. Begin at the Columbia Icefield Glacier Discovery Centre, located in Jasper National Park, and delight in views of more than 100 glaciers and stunning alpine landscapes.

7. Peggy’s Cove Day Trip from Halifax, from $54.95

Learn about one of Nova Scotia’s most picturesque spots on this half-day trip to Peggy’s Cove. Receive an insightful overview and then take a self-guided tour to explore the small fishing village. Take your time to soak up its quaint charm and understand why it’s considered an artist’s paradise.
